Dhamar: The Martyr of the Quran Center for Teaching the Holy Quran and its Sciences at Al-Madrasa Al-Shamsiyya and the Grand Mosque in Dhamar city organized a concluding event for the Ramadan Quran memorization and mastery course for the year 1447 AH, honoring the participants.

According to Yemen News Agency, the Director of the General Authority for Endowments and Guidance office in the governorate, Faisal Al-Hatfi, highlighted the role of the Holy Quran as a guiding methodology for the nation. He emphasized the importance of encouraging youth to memorize and recite the Quran, urging them to reflect on its teachings and apply them in their daily lives. Al-Hatfi also commended the organizers of the Quran memorization and recitation courses, advocating for the adoption of innovative educational methods to elevate the Holy Quran as a priority.

Zakaria Al-Hamzi, the Deputy Director of Al-Madrasa Al-Shamsiyya, reported that 90 students participated in the course, which concentrated on memorizing five parts of the Quran. He underlined the significance of such courses in fostering a competitive spirit among students to memorize the Quran, preparing future generations with Quranic knowledge and culture.

The event, coordinated with the General Authority for Endowments and Guidance, concluded with the recognition of outstanding students who received certificates of appreciation and in-kind prizes.
